Output eb35b768f67cbcfdcdce54f8ffdfe8f736a489947551aa2234ae769531ed4ef9:0

value
66640114
script pubkey
OP_0 OP_PUSHBYTES_20 bef3fba69cebd01384aad621dbb2513604bc0aed
address
bc1qhmelhf5ua0gp8p926csahvj3xcztczhdrv2hgm
transaction
eb35b768f67cbcfdcdce54f8ffdfe8f736a489947551aa2234ae769531ed4ef9
confirmations
342093
spent
true